This is a Matlab interface to Hendrickson and Leland's "Chaco" graphpartitioning software (version 2.0). The interface is part of Gilbertand Teng's Matlab mesh partitioning toolbox. It runs under Matlabversion 4.2c or later. See the references below for more information.------------------------------------------------------------------Installation instructions:1. Unpack the partitioning toolbox from "meshpart.uu". (You've probably already done this.) This creates a directory "meshpart" full of m-files, with a subdirectory "chaco" containing a copy of this README and the other files listed below. 2. Put the "meshpart" directory on your Matlab path. At this point you can use all of the mesh partitioning toolbox except Chaco.3. Unpack the Chaco distribution (not included here) per the instructions in its manual. Don't put it in the meshpart/chaco directory; put it wherever else you want to.4. In the meshpart/chaco directory, edit "Makefile" per the instructions contained in it, to reflect the locations of Chaco and Matlab and any necessary changes.5. In the meshpart/chaco directory, utter "make". This compiles everything and puts "mlchaco.mexsol" in the meshpart directory.6. After testing everything, utter "make clean" to delete the object files.This has been tested on Sun workstations running Solaris 2.5, using gcc 2.7.2 and Matlab 4.2c, with Chaco 2.0. It should be fairly simple to modify the Makefile to create a mex-file for any Unix system. ------------------------------------------------------------------The mex-file version of Chaco includes the following files. All namesare relative to the subdirectory "chaco" of the mesh partitioningtoolbox directory. README is this file. Makefile builds the Matlab version of Chaco. ../chaco.m is the m-file interface. ../mlchaco.m is the help text for mlchaco.mex. mlchaco.c is the glue between chaco.m and Chaco's "interface" routine. User_Params.verbose can be copied to "../User_Params" to make Chaco print some information about what it's doing. See the Chaco manual for details. User_Params.debug can be copied to "../User_Params" to make Chaco print even more information. user_params.c replaces the version in Chaco: it changes some defaults, including turning off most normal output. smalloc.c replaces the version in Chaco: it uses Matlab's mxCalloc and mxFree instead of malloc and free. bail.c replaces the version in Chaco: it returns to Matlab instead of exiting. check_input.c replaces the version in Chaco: it calls "chaco_check_graph" instead of "check_graph" to avoid a name conflict with an internal Matlab routine. chaco_check_graph.c replaces check_graph.c in Chaco; it's identical except for the name, which conflicts with an internal Matlab routine.------------------------------------------------------------------References:Chaco is described in B. Hendrickson and R. Leland, "The ChacoUser's Guide (Version 2.0)", Sandia National Laboratories reportSAND94-2692, October 1994. Inquiries about obtaining Chaco should be directed to Bruce Hendrickson, bahendr@cs.sandia.gov.The Matlab Mesh Partitioning Toolbox (which includes this interfaceto Chaco but not Chaco itself) is described in J. Gilbert, G. Miller,and S. Teng, "Geometric Mesh Partitioning: Implementation and Experiments", Xerox PARC report CSL-94-13, 1994. The report isavailable as ftp://parcftp.xerox.com/pub/gilbert/csl9413.ps.Zand the Toolbox is ftp://parcftp.xerox.com/pub/gilbert/meshpart.uuInquiries about the Toolbox should be directed to John Gilbert,gilbert@parc.xerox.com.Chaco is copyrighted by Sandia Corporation.
